Web made of terracotta (fired clay), ancient greek pots and cups, or “vases” as they are normally called, were fashioned into a variety of shapes and sizes (see above), and very often a vessel’s form correlates with its intended function. Web several types of vase, especially the taller ones, could be made in plastic forms (also called figure vases or relief vases) where the body was shaped sculpturally (somewhat in the manner of the modern toby jug), typically to form a human head.
